Correct, "Baseball Rule Differences" by Carl Childress.
It covers the differences between OBR, FED, NCAA, & NAIA. But it's really more than that.
It's really a pretty comprehensive book covering interpretations for the myriad situations that might occur in baseball game (over 500 such), and then provides the Official Interpretations (where available) & authoritative opinions which guide the proper ruling on the situation in question, while pointing out the diffferences (where they exist) between the codes addressed.
I believe Carl initially published it in the early 80's and then published an "updated" version each year (with the conspicuous exception of 2007), including new rulings made and addressing rule changes since the previous edition.
